Preparing competent cells using CaCl2 Buffer: 60 mM CaCl2, 10 mM PIPES, 15% v/v glycerol, pH 7.0 For 500 mL: 4.4 g CaCl2, 1.73 g PIPES, 75 mL glycerol (PIPES won't dissolve until you adjust the pH- put pH meter in undissolved solution and add NaOH to indicated pH, let stir more, then adjust pH again) Use within 6 months if possible. Positively charged calcium ions attract both the negatively charged DNA backbone and the negatively charged groups in the LPS inner core.
